众所周知,python是一门非常高级的编程语言,学习完之后可以从事的岗位有很多,发展前景也非常不错。而且学完python之后不仅可以从事IT相关工作,还是提高我们工作效率的一大关键,对传统行业的工作者也有很大的帮助。本文为大家推荐7个好用的python效率工具,快来学习一下吧。
1、Pandas-用于数据分析
Pandas是一个强大的分析结构化数据的工具集;它的使用基础是Numpy;用于数据挖掘和数据分析,同时也提供数据清洗功能。
2、Selenium-自动化测试
Selenium是一个用于web应用程序测试的工具,可以从终端用户的角度来测试应用程序。通过在不同浏览器中运行测试,更容易发现浏览器的不兼容性。并且它适用许多浏览器。
3、Flask-微型web框架
Flask是一个轻量级的可定制框架,使用python语言编写,较其他同类型框架更为灵活、轻便、安全且容易上手。Flask是目前十分流行的web框架。开发者可以使用python语言快速实现一个网站或者web服务。
4、Scrapy-页面爬取
Scrapy能够为你提供强大支持,使你能够精确地从网站中爬取信息。是非常实用。
5、Requests-做API调用
Requests是一个功能强大的HTTP库。有了它可以轻松地发送请求。无需手动向网址添加查询字符串。除此之外还有许多功能,比如authorization处理、JSON/XML解析、session处理等。
6、Faker-用于创建假数据
Faker是一个python包,为您生成假数据。无论是需要引导数据库、创建好看的XML文档、填写您的持久性来强调测试它,还是从生产服务中获取的同名数据,Faker都适合您。
7、Pillow-进行图像处理
python图像处理工具-pillow有相当强大的图像处理功能。当平时需要做图像处理时就可以用到,毕竟作为开发人员,应该选择功能更强大的图片处理工具。